The Hospice Program at Baystate Visiting Nurse Association & Hospice provides comfort and support to patients and their loved ones during the final journey of life. The goal is to help patients and their families achieve the highest quality of living even when life is measured in months, weeks or days.

Baystate Visiting Nurse Association & Hospice is a comprehensive home health care agency committed to providing the highest quality care to patients and families, primarily in the home setting. We have the expertise to meet individual needs by bringing experienced nurses, rehabilitation therapists, social workers, and home care aides to patients' homes.
